Output f75df3e8d6ff45419ea05fc4d2c3d7fa2bbd9fd19af7819bc584a12d157ba21c:9

value
15239130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37499fb0d8dff73a10df9ecc7166f4e576cf8 OP_EQUAL
address
3BMEXGYjUiHEMUbtamBYS7e8RxtWqptcHa
transaction
f75df3e8d6ff45419ea05fc4d2c3d7fa2bbd9fd19af7819bc584a12d157ba21c
spent
true